How does SecureStack work?
SecureStack offers protection from all buffer overflow attacks that try to inject and execute arbitrary code on your system. SecureStack flags data sections as non-executable, and it detects and prevents any attempt to run illegitimate code, thus making it impossible for attackers to gain control of your system.

What is SecureStack?
SecureStack consists of a kernel mode driver for Windows NT/2000 (Intel). The driver ensures that data stored in memory cannot be executed by smashing the stack and is application independent. This means that once Secure Stack is installed your system will be protected.

Features:

  1. SecureStack provides protection for user mode applications (including services), but not for kernel mode drivers,
  2. SecureStack is independent of the server applications,
  3. SecureStack currently supports only uni-processor machines,
  4. SecureStack provides protection from remote buffer overflow attacks for Windows NT 4.0, and Windows 2000 with any existing and future service packs and for hardware platform with Intel Pentium, MMX,
